screen是linux下的一種多重視窗管理程序。在使用telnet或SSH遠程登陸linux時, 若是鏈接非正常中 斷,從新鏈接時,系統將開一個新的session,沒法恢復原來的session.screen命令能夠解決這個問題。 screen默認狀況下是沒有安裝。如今我把安裝過程在下面作一下展現: #screen
#df 找到光盤路徑
#rpm -ivh /run......screen......rpm 安裝screen安裝包,不須要手工寫按Tab鍵補全
#screen 成功
如今模擬一個在程序運行過程當中,窗口忽然關閉,看看可否影響正在運行的程序。
#screen
#ping 192.168.37.2 關閉端口
#ps aux 查看當前運行的文件
#screen ls 查看到一個處於被剝離的會話
#screen -r鏈接回到原來運行的會話(備註:如果只有一個會話按screen-r 就能回到當前的會話,如果多個的話須要指定特定的會話)
screen 還有一個功能是經過創建遠程鏈接,給他人提供幫助
#ssh root@172.16.128.164 知道被幫助人的帳戶,IP 密碼創建鏈接
#screen -x xiaohong 加入會話(備註:對方發起我加入的)
#screen -S xiaohong 發起會話(備註:我方發起的)
成功創建會話的界面
exit:完成後退出會話
CTRL+A+D:同時按下退出臨時會話。
以上涉及到的命令簡單彙總以下:
學習是一個按部就班的過程,我會把本身學到的點滴知識放到這裏。一來想看本身知識逐漸積累的過程給本身帶來的成就感,二來把個人學習成果與你們分享,但願可以共同進步。linux